That depends on which Ifor you are talking about, how many horses you are intended to travel and how big they are, as well as whether you are buying new or second hand. The Batesons are larger than the smaller two-horse ifors (505/605) and they have the front ramp on the opposite side to the older Ifors, which makes unloading the horse on the RHS of the trailer easier. I've had both makes and I prefer the Bateson personally, but I had a big horse and only ever travelled him on his own.

The latest model of Ifor doesn't get such good reviews as the older ones which might be an issue if you are buying new. It also means the second hand, older model are now quite expensive.
